Simple Machines One
vocabulary definitions only.
Question | Answer |
---|---|
Machine | A device that makes work easier. |
Input Force | The work you DO on a machine. |
Output Force | The work done BY the machine on an object. |
Mechanical Efficiency | A comparison of a machine’s work output with the work input. |
Mechanical Advantage | Number of times the machine multiplies the force. |
First Class Lever | A lever with the fulcrum in the middle. |
Second Class Lever | A lever with the load or resistance in the middle. |
Third Class Lever | A lever with the input (effort) force in the middle. |
Fulcrum | Fixed position on a lever. |
Compound Machine | A machine made up of 2 or more simple machines. |
Screw | An inclined plane wrapped around a post. |
MA = 1 | Mechanical Advantage of a fixed pulley. |
MA = 2 | Mechanical Advantage of a movable pulley. |
